Casement Window Repair: A Comprehensive Guide
Casement windows, known for their practical beauty and energy performance, are a popular option amongst property owners. These windows, which open outward on hinges like a door, can considerably boost a home's visual appeal and ventilation. However, like any other home component, casement windows can experience wear and tear over time, demanding repairs. This thorough guide intends to provide readers with the essential details to determine common issues, perform fundamental repairs, and understand when professional help is required.
Comprehending Casement Windows
Before delving into the repair procedure, it's vital to comprehend the structure and systems of casement windows. These windows consist of a frame, a sash (the moveable part), hinges, and a crank or deal with system. They are typically made from materials such as wood, vinyl, or aluminum, each with its own set of upkeep requirements.
Typical Casement Window Issues
Leaking or Drafty Windows
Signs: Water leak, drafts, and cold spots near the window.Causes: Loose seals, damaged weatherstripping, and misaligned sashes.
Sticking or Hard-to-Open Windows
Symptoms: Difficulty in opening or closing the window.Causes: Warped frames, collected dirt, or malfunctioning hinges.
Broken Crank or Handle
Symptoms: The crank or manage does not turn efficiently or is broken.Causes: Wear and tear, overuse, or unexpected damage.
Rotted or Damaged Wood
Symptoms: Cracking, swelling, or decomposing of wood parts.Causes: Exposure to moisture, lack of correct sealing, and age.
Cracked or Broken Glass

Weatherstripping helps seal the window, avoiding leaks and drafts. Here's how to replace it:
Step 1: Remove the old weatherstripping utilizing an energy knife.Step 2: Clean the window frame and sash to guarantee a correct fit.Action 3: Measure the length of the weatherstripping required.Step 4: Cut the brand-new weatherstripping to size and install it, ensuring it is tight and safe.2. Lubing the Crank Mechanism
A well-lubricated crank system can fix numerous opening and closing problems:
Step 1: Open the window fully and eliminate the crank handle.Step 2: Clean the mechanism with a dry cloth to get rid of dirt and debris.Step 3: Apply a silicone-based lubricant to the gears and pivot points.Step 4: Reattach the crank manage and check the window repairs near me's operation.3. Tightening or Adjusting Hinges
Loose or misaligned hinges can cause the window to stick or not close appropriately:
Step 1: Identify the loose hinge and use a screwdriver to tighten up the screws.Step 2: If the screws are stripped, utilize longer screws or fill the holes with wood filler and re-drill.Step 3: Adjust the hinge positions if essential to make sure the window closes properly.4. Dealing With Rotted Wood
For wood casement windows, dealing with decomposed wood is crucial to preserve structural integrity:
Step 1: Scrape away the decomposed wood utilizing a sculpt or scraper.Step 2: Apply a wood hardener to the impacted locations.Step 3: Fill the spaces with wood filler and permit it to dry.Step 4: Sand the filled areas smooth and paint or stain to match the existing window.5. Changing Broken Glass
If the glass is cracked or broken, it needs to be replaced to guarantee safety and effectiveness:

Q: How often should I check and maintain my casement windows?A: It is advised to examine and preserve casement windows at least as soon as a year. This consists of inspecting seals, cleaning up the windows, and lubricating the crank system.
Q: What type of lubricant should I utilize for the crank mechanism?A: A silicone-based lubricant is perfect as it is water-resistant and supplies smooth operation without attracting dirt.
Q: Can I paint over the weatherstripping?A: No, painting over weatherstripping can minimize its effectiveness. Instead, remove the old weatherstripping, replace it, and then paint the surrounding locations.
